I have a few of those HF drying towels. I just bought another one the other day. I really like them. Gray side: 90% polyester, 10% polyamide; Neon green side: 75% polyester, 25% polyamide. I just use the neon side. I only use the grey side for glass if I need to. They are a good size and really soak up the water. I find they are just the right weight to put down on the vehicle. I mean you can control it so that it pretty much lays flat. When it gets wet it doesn’t get to heavy. If you get 2 towels you won’t have any issues drying a vehicle since you have a back up if needed. The price for even 2 towels is awesome. I use rinseless solution as my drying aid when I do a soap contact wash so the panels can be a little wetter than normal but I just use 2 towels and it works very well. I have a couple of medium sized gauntlet drying towel and only use 1 of them for some light touch ups at the end if I need to.

I'm not sure of the ph tolerance of the 3 in 1, so I really can't answer truthfully. Spray sealants are generally weaker than full ceramic coatings, and weak enough to be harmed by higher ph strip washes. That one though is an amazing product from what I've seen.
